Daily Duties at Advance Engineering Company:

Review daily build plan and finished goods inventory. Manage continuous improvement activities. Approve purchase orders. Calculate staffing levels. Direct corrective action activities. Coach Production Supervisors and Material Planner. Mediate Maintenance and Toolroom issues. Meet with Quality and Engineering Managers concerning the status of new part launches. Check with the Controller concerning month to date expenses compared to budget.
